China Hong Kong Hong Kong Alibaba Cloud
Websites on 8.212.4.201
- Domain names that have been bound:
- 2026-04-15-----2026-04-15jmbt06.68ip.net
- website server lookup history
- xiaonvhai4.top
- 91pron.com
- ll331pro.com
- www.skarlo.com
- vmos.com
- www.taibest.com
- jp10.suansuanru.cc
- bu699.com
- xjjmv.com
- x10dahl3244o3n3ylq.com
- 9xfx.com
- haoyounv7.top
- www.angelpe.com
- m5v.cc389.com
- x33853.com
- danzhigu.com
- kxhs17.com
- lld18.top
- x10ewlhx088a6.com
- www.www19eee.com
- hosting ip address lookup history
- 14.218.58.11
- 104.20.54.144
- 151.101.130.37
- 177.93.106.42
- 165.154.42.176
- 13.126.138.168
- 223.104.86.243
- 120.26.218.187
- 66.235.201.193
- 18.155.204.224
- 223.221.183.23
- 112.52.53.102
- 54.196.79.16
- 144.196.56.19
- 39.100.226.173
- 157.254.193.130
- 112.17.237.42
- 218.25.75.220
- 104.124.234.144
- 45.194.53.52
